Latest Patents
Smith's latest patents include innovations related to piperidine quaternary salts and their applications as CCR-3 receptor antagonists. These inventions focus on 4-aroylpiperidine derivatives that serve as CCR-3 receptor antagonists. The patents detail pharmaceutical compositions containing these compounds, methods for their use, and methods for preparing them.
